How to Transport a Motorcycle on a Truck?

When loading your motorcycle onto a truck bed, you may want to use a ramp that has two levels. This way, a person pushing the bike can walk next to it. You should also secure the bike with a wheel chock against the front of the truck bed. This will help prevent the bike from rolling backwards during loading.

The first step is to measure the length and width of the truck bed. You should also measure the bike’s wheel base, excluding the overhang. Once you’ve got the measurements, you’re ready to secure the bike on the bed. Once the bike is strapped securely, you can attach a tow strap to the front of the motorcycle.

Once you have the proper equipment, you’re ready to load your motorcycle onto the bed of a truck. Before you hit the road, be sure to have a team of people to assist you. You’ll also need tie-downs, wheel chocks, and tow straps. Wheel chocks are essential for preventing the bike from rolling. Next, you should strap the handlebars of the motorcycle to the sides of the flatbed. Finally, you’ll need a soft loop strap to secure the rear of the bike’s swing arm to the front of the truck.

How Do You Transport a Heavy Motorcycle?

If you’re planning on transporting a motorcycle, you may wonder how to properly load it onto the truck bed. It’s possible to use a ramp to lower the motorcycle’s height and secure it to the bed securely. However, you must ensure that the motorcycle is secured properly to prevent it from rolling and damaging the bed of the truck. To make the process easier, you may want to get a friend to help you load the motorcycle. They can hold the front end of the bike while you climb up the truck bed.

Before you strap your bike to the bed of your truck, you should secure it with straps or wheel chocks. Wheel chocks give the front wheel a secure anchor point, while straps can be bolted in place. If you don’t have wheel chocks, you can borrow one. Make sure that you use the right length and type of straps so that they don’t damage the paint on the motorcycle. Also, you should tie down any metal tie-down points in the bed, such as the walls and rails.
